What is Anxiety?
Anxiety is a natural response to stress, fear, or uncertainty. It's the feeling of worry, nervousness, or unease, often accompanied by physical sensations such as a racing heart, shallow breathing, or dizziness. While occasional anxiety is a normal part of life, chronic or excessive anxiety can interfere with your emotional well-being and daily functioning. It can manifest in various forms, including generalized anxiety, panic attacks, social anxiety, or specific phobias.

How Therapy Can Help with Anxiety
Therapy can provide you with the tools and support to manage anxiety effectively. In my practice I use a blend of therapeutic approaches tailored to your unique needs:
-
Psychodynamic Therapy: To help you understand the root causes of your anxiety by exploring past experiences, unconscious thought patterns, and unresolved emotional conflicts.
-
Cognitive Behavioral Therapy (CBT): To help you identify and change unhelpful thought pattern and responses that contribute to your anxiety.
- Art Therapy: For mindfulness, self-expression and to help you uncover deeper insights into your anxiety.
